so everything is going good, i still see a few flatworms, but barley any. i may lower the salinity a bit more, and then when i raise it back to normal i will just add salt directly to the sump and also add a big dose of levamisole to really make sure there are no more of these buggers.

im kind of thinking about redoing my left island of rock. it looks really cool, but its starting to be not the best rock formation. for one,there's a dead spot on the left side of the rock that wouldn't be easily fixed.
second of all it doesn't have a whole lot of space for corals.
third of all, it really doesn't have a lot of hiding places. it has beasicaly one big hole in a rock and thats it.
the only thing im worried about is not being able to make it look as nice as before, and then not being able to get it back to normal if i want to.
